The Richmond - San Rafael Bridge is the only road link directly between Marin County and the East Bay.

The current base toll is $6, charged in the westbound direction. Carpool vehicles with 3 or more persons can cross the bridge for $3 on weekdays between 5am - 10am and 3pm - 6pm. FasTrak is accepted for payment. As of March 21, 2020, drivers who don't have FasTrak transponder should drive through the toll gate as toll takers are no longer stationed due to concerns of COVID-19. A "Toll violation" bill would be sent to the vehicle owner by mail, but no penalty (only the toll needs to be paid) would be assessed.

A $0.50 discount is given for FasTrak users making a second toll crossing of the day during weekday commute hours (5-10am and 3-7pm).

Bikes and pedestrians

A pedestrian and bicycle path is available on the upper deck/north lane of the bridge. Path may close periodically due to maintenance.
